-
MANCHESTER
Regular price $357Regular priceUnit price per$510-30%Sale price $357Cotton-cashmere jersey henley shirt -
MANCHESTER
Regular price $357 Sold OutRegular priceUnit price per$510-30%Sale price $357 Sold OutCotton-cashmere jersey henley shirt